PLTR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

1,132 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Palantir (PLTR)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$20.3B — up 34% from $15.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 203 funds opened new PLTR positions and 84 closed out — a net gain of 119 holders — while 470 added to existing stakes and 321 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Norges Bank, adding an estimated $180M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$544M.
